Online Periodical System Moves to Meet Buzzword-Compliance

TurboPress is not "the best thing since sliced bread for online publishers" but rather a "fully featured optimized functionality which postdates the launch phase of useability-enhanced gluten-consumables for the content management-focused cross-media audience".

"We figure buzzword-compliance is the next big thing, having survived the Y2K meltdown," says WebCentre Development Director Peter Hyde, vowing to dramatically increase the syllable count in describing the new TurboPress Web automation system for managing online periodicals.

Communication is the key to publishing, and Hyde admits to being puzzled at times when trying to understand the features of software targeted at online publishers.

"We try to be straightforward about what TurboPress can do for people trying to manage online newspapers, magazines or journals," says Hyde. "It puts all your issue content online with all the indexing, links and site structure, everything, done automatically. It lets you decide who gets to see what and how much they pay. It lets you talk to all your subscribers or site visitors or authors quickly and simply. You can run on-site surveys, track visitors and see what people are looking at, check out how well your advertisers are doing. It really is the best thing since sliced bread."

Hyde cites strong links between publishers and software engineers in the WebCentre development team as contributing to both the tight focus on publisher needs and the clear description of what the TurboPress system does.

"We prefer plain English to all the marketing speak, but maybe we can offer a buzzword-compliant section on the TurboPress site -- just look for the huge animated gif announcing a flash movie..."
